OU Poem #1

First in a series of poems for OU week by Chuck, the once and future Poet Laureate of South Main.

What happens to a Cat defurred?
Does it dry up
like a corn husk in the sun?
Or try but fail to score--
And then run?
Does it stink like patchouli oil?
Or give up and get real high--
Make a bowl from foil?

Maybe it reflects
on its nasty luck.

Or does it just suck?
